9.4.12 Dual Port RAM Abnormal (No Axis Unit display code)
<ERROR DESCRIPTION>
An Axis Unit DUAL PORt RAM error occurred while attempting communications between the
AXIS UNIt and the Main Unit.
<CHECK ITEMS>
1. Check the connected Axis Units for indications of abnormality. A locked-up display, an
illuminated Abnormal LED, and failure to count down are all possible indicators of a
malfunctioning Axis Unit. If all Axis Units appear to be functional, the problem is likely to
be found in another System component. Use the Axis Unit (if applicable) connected
directly to the Main Unit ribbon cable to perform the following inspections.
2. Turn off the power and verify the communication bus ribbon cable is in good condition and
is properly connected to both the Main Unit and the AXIS UNIT.
3. Remove the suspected Axis Unit PCB and Main Unit Multi PCB. Verify compatibility of
software between the two (2) units. This may be of concern if a board has been replaced.
4. Verify correct installation of all removable IC chips on both the Axis Unit and Multi PCBs.
5. Reinstall the Axis Unit and Multi PCBs. Ensure that the boards are properly seated.
6. Ensure that the Main Unit and Axis Unit are not located near any strong electrical or
magnetic fields.
7. Verify correct Axis Unit input voltage and ensure the power cable is properly connected.
8. Turn on the power. If problem still exists, replace the Multi PCB. (Refer to Section 8.3)
9. If problem still exists, replace the affected AXIS UNit. (Refer to Section 8.3)
10. If problem still exists, replace the entire Main Unit. (Refer to Section 8.3)
9.4.13 Input Power Over Abnormal (Axis Unit display code "d5, d6")
<ERROR DESCRIPTION>
The measurement of input power exceeds the set limit of 200~230 VAC ± 10% (180~253V).
When this error message is displayed on the CRT, the corresponding Axis Unit display should
be checked for an Abnormal code. Refer to Section 9.6 for more information regarding this
failure type.
